The Storied Life of A.J. Fikry: A Tale of Transformation and Second Chances

In the quaint town of Alice Island, the faded Island Books sign hangs over the porch of a Victorian cottage with the motto “No Man Is an Island; Every Book Is a World.” A.J. Fikry, the owner of the bookstore, finds his life taking unexpected turns after the death of his wife, declining bookstore sales, and the theft of his prized collection of Poe poems. Through a series of events, A.J. is given the chance to remake his life and discover the true value of books and human connections.

Characters

  • Maya: A young girl left in A.J.'s bookstore who becomes a significant part of his life.
  • Amelia Loman: A Knightley Press sales representative who forms an unexpected bond with A.J.
  • A.J. Fikry: The irascible bookstore owner whose life takes a transformative journey.
  • Daniel Parrish: A musician who becomes involved in A.J.'s life.
  • Ismay Parrish: A.J.'s sister-in-law who tries to help him navigate his struggles.
  • Marian Wallace: An author who impacts A.J.'s life in unexpected ways.
  • Nicholas Lambaise: The well-intentioned police officer on Alice Island who interacts with A.J. throughout the story.

Detailed Summary

A.J. Fikry's life in Alice Island is far from what he anticipated. Struggling with grief over the loss of his wife and dwindling bookstore sales, A.J. finds solace in his rare collection of Poe poems. When the collection is stolen, A.J. feels like he has lost a vital part of himself. However, a mysterious package arrives at the bookstore, leading A.J. on a journey of rediscovery and transformation.

As A.J. navigates through his grief and reexamines his relationships with those around him, he begins to see the world in a new light. Amelia, the persistent sales rep, and Maya, the young girl left in his bookstore, bring unexpected joy and meaning into A.J.'s life. Through the power of books and the connections they create, A.J. finds hope and redemption in the most unlikely of places.

Analysis

"The Storied Life of A.J. Fikry" by Gabrielle Zevin is a heartwarming tale of loss, love, and the power of storytelling. Through A.J.'s journey, the author explores themes of grief, renewal, and the transformative nature of human connections. The characters in the novel are well-developed and relatable, each adding depth and richness to the story.

Zevin's writing style is poignant and engaging, drawing readers into A.J.'s world and inviting them to reflect on their own lives and relationships. The incorporation of books and literature throughout the novel adds an extra layer of depth, appealing to book lovers and bibliophiles alike.

Overall, "The Storied Life of A.J. Fikry" is a touching and memorable read that will resonate with readers long after they have turned the final page. It serves as a reminder of the importance of second chances, the beauty of human connection, and the enduring power of storytelling.
